Mini-TES, or Miniature Thermal Emission Spectrometer, is a scientific instrument designed to analyze the mineral composition of planetary surfaces by measuring thermal infrared radiation. It was specifically developed for use on Mars rovers, such as the Spirit and Opportunity rovers, which were part of NASA's Mars Exploration Rover mission. The Mini-TES works by detecting the thermal emission from the surface materials as they are heated by the Sun.
